WebIn 1929, 39 of the 60 independent motherhouses in the United States formed the Sisters of Mercy of the Union. This amalgamation united more than 5,000 sisters into six provinces. The Vatican II Council called upon the Sisters of Mercy to read “the signs of the times” and reconnect with the charism of their foundress, Catherine McAuley. Catherine McAuley was born in comfortable circumstances in Dublin, Ireland, in 1778, and was orphaned and destitute by age 20. ... thus founding the Sisters of Mercy. The charism of Catherine McAuley soon spread across Ireland and England.
